OK. ive trying to get my car to idle .. no luck yet.
using the TMO software.. i see that theres a sensor that goes from high to low and makes the car go up and down on the idle..
it shows that its the TDC Sensor..
i dont know what it is...
any help with this is??
 
I believe you just have to get a new cas. On a 1g its this round thing beside the valve cover on the rear passenger side. You can either get a green top or black top cas, either will work but the black top cas is a hall-effect sensor that has higher resolution. Look around at a junk yard or on the classifieds.
